What Makes Premium Football Uniforms Different?

Football uniforms operate under more extreme conditions than most sports apparel. The combination of high-impact contact, extreme temperatures, and intense physical output creates demands that basic athletic fabrics struggle to meet.

Contact sports require fabrics that maintain their shape and performance after repeated impacts. Players are tackled, blocked, and hit on every play. Fabrics that stretch out, tear, or lose their fit under physical stress need to be replaced frequently and can affect performance during games.

Temperature management is critical because football spans from August heat to November cold. Players generate enormous body heat during play, but they also face weather extremes that vary from scorching pre-season practices to freezing late-season games. The best football fabrics manage moisture and body heat regardless of the external temperature.

Fit precision matters in football more than many sports. A loose jersey provides handholds for defenders. A tight jersey restricts the shoulder and arm movement needed for throwing, catching, and tackling. Premium football uniforms achieve a compression-like fit that stays close to the body without limiting range of motion.

Ventilation placement must account for the equipment worn over the uniform. Shoulder pads cover the upper torso, so ventilation zones need to be placed where they actually contact open air, typically at the sides, lower torso, and back panels below the pad line.

Key characteristics of elite football uniforms:

  • Shape retention through repeated physical contact
  • Moisture management across extreme temperature ranges
  • Compression-like fit that does not restrict movement
  • Ventilation zones placed to work with shoulder pads and equipment

adidas Primeknit Technology in Football: How It Performs

Primeknit is adidas's pinnacle fabric construction technology, and the A1 Primeknit football line represents its application to the most demanding team sport. Here is what the technology delivers.

  • Precision-knit construction creates the jersey as a single, seamless piece of fabric engineered with different knit densities in different zones. Areas that need stretch, like the shoulders and arms, use a more open knit pattern. Areas that need structure, like the torso, use a tighter pattern. This eliminates the need for seams that can chafe, restrict, or fail under the physical demands of football.
  • AEROREADY moisture management is built into the Primeknit fiber structure. Sweat moves from the skin to the outer surface through the knit channels, where it evaporates. During August two-a-days and high-intensity fourth quarters, AEROREADY keeps the fabric from becoming saturated and heavy.
  • Adaptive stretch allows the Primeknit fabric to move with the athlete in every direction. Unlike traditional cut-and-sew jerseys that restrict in certain positions, Primeknit stretches uniformly when a receiver reaches for a high catch, a lineman engages in a block, or a quarterback winds up for a deep throw. The fabric returns to its original shape immediately.
  • Mapped ventilation zones use an open-mesh knit pattern in the side panels and lower torso where air can actually reach the skin beneath shoulder pads. These zones are engineered specifically for the areas that overheat most during football play.
  • Recycled polyester composition makes up the Primeknit fiber blend, supporting adidas's sustainability goals without compromising the performance that elite programs expect. The recycled content delivers identical stretch, breathability, and durability to virgin materials.

How to Choose adidas Football Jerseys for Your Team

Outfitting a football team with A1 Primeknit requires attention to fit, customization, and program needs:

  • Size with shoulder pads on. Football jerseys must be fitted over equipment. The Primeknit fit is designed to work with standard shoulder pads, but having players try on samples with their pads ensures the right size for game day.
  • Consider position-specific fit preferences. Skill position players (WR, DB, RB) typically prefer a tighter fit that eliminates grab points. Linemen may prefer slightly more room in the torso for comfort and mobility.
  • Order matching pants from the same collection. A1 Primeknit [football pants](/collections/adidas-a1-primeknit) coordinate with the jerseys for a complete uniform kit.
  • Plan customization timeline. Screen-printed numbers, team names, and conference logos require lead time. Start the ordering process well before the season.
  • Order backup jerseys. Football is a contact sport. Jerseys get damaged, stained, and sometimes torn during games. Having replacements ready prevents uniform issues during the season.

Football Jersey Care and Maintenance for Teams

Protecting your investment in A1 Primeknit jerseys requires proper care:

  • Wash after every use. Football jerseys accumulate sweat, grass, turf rubber, and body oils that break down fabric if left between uses.
  • Cold water only. Hot water can cause shrinkage in the Primeknit structure and damage the adaptive stretch properties.
  • Turn jerseys inside out. This protects printed numbers and graphics while ensuring the sweat-contact side gets thoroughly cleaned.
  • No fabric softener. Softener coats the knit fibers and blocks the AEROREADY moisture channels.
  • Hang dry when possible. The Primeknit structure retains its precision fit better with air drying than machine drying. If using a dryer, low heat only.
  • Inspect after each game. Check for snags, small tears, or loose threads and address them before the next wash to prevent further damage.

What makes Primeknit different from regular football jerseys?

Traditional football jerseys use cut-and-sew construction, stitching flat fabric panels together. Primeknit is knitted as a single piece with varying densities, eliminating seams that can chafe under shoulder pads. The knit construction provides superior stretch in all directions compared to woven fabrics, and it returns to its original shape immediately. This means a better fit, more freedom of movement, and greater comfort during the physical demands of football.
